Abstract
Experimental results on inclusive ϕ production are compared with the Lund model for lowp T hadronic interactions. The data is based on a sample of 600,000 ϕ mesons in the kinematic rangep T <1.0 (GeV/c)2 and 0.0<x F<0.4, produced in π±,K ±,p and\(\bar p\) Be interactions at 100 GeV/c and 120 GeV/c incident momentum. The Lund model reproduces the shapes of the longitudinal differential cross sections reasonably well, but the relative cross sections for incident, π,K andp show a discrepancy with the data.
